How to Automatically Update Google Sheets? With Ease

Are you tired of manually updating your Google Sheets every time you need to refresh the data? Do you struggle with keeping your spreadsheets up-to-date and accurate? If so, you’re not alone. In today’s fast-paced digital world, data is constantly changing, and it’s essential to have a system in place to automatically update your Google Sheets. In this comprehensive guide, we’ll explore the importance of automating Google Sheets updates and provide step-by-step instructions on how to do it.

Why Automate Google Sheets Updates?

Automating Google Sheets updates can save you a significant amount of time and reduce the risk of human error. When you manually update your spreadsheets, you’re more likely to make mistakes, such as typing errors or forgetting to update certain cells. Additionally, manual updates can be time-consuming, especially if you have multiple spreadsheets to update. By automating the process, you can ensure that your data is accurate and up-to-date, without having to spend hours updating each sheet individually.

Another benefit of automating Google Sheets updates is that it allows you to focus on more important tasks. When you’re manually updating spreadsheets, you’re taking away from other tasks that require your attention. By automating the process, you can free up more time to focus on other aspects of your business or personal projects.

How to Automate Google Sheets Updates?

There are several ways to automate Google Sheets updates, and the method you choose will depend on your specific needs and requirements. Here are a few options:

Using Google Apps Script

Google Apps Script is a powerful tool that allows you to automate tasks and processes within Google Sheets. You can use Apps Script to create custom scripts that update your spreadsheets automatically. Here’s a step-by-step guide to get you started:

  1. Open your Google Sheet and click on the “Tools” menu.
  2. Click on “Script editor” to open the Google Apps Script editor.
  3. Create a new script by clicking on the “Create” button.
  4. Write your script using the Apps Script language.
  5. Save your script and click on the “Run” button to execute it.

Here’s an example script that updates a Google Sheet every hour: (See Also: How to Divide a Sum in Google Sheets? Easy Steps)


function updateSheet() {
  var sheet = SpreadsheetApp.getActiveSheet();
  var data = [];
  var url = 'https://example.com/data';
  var options = {
    'method': 'GET',
    'headers': {
      'Authorization': 'Bearer YOUR_API_KEY'
    }
  };
  var response = UrlFetchApp.fetch(url, options);
  var data = JSON.parse(response.getContentText());
  sheet.getRange(1, 1, data.length, data[0].length).setValues(data);
}

This script uses the `UrlFetchApp` service to fetch data from an external API and then updates the Google Sheet with the new data.

Using Google Sheets Add-ons

Google Sheets add-ons are third-party tools that can be installed within your Google Sheet to automate tasks and processes. There are many add-ons available that can help you automate Google Sheets updates, such as:

  • AutoUpdate: This add-on allows you to schedule automatic updates for your Google Sheets.
  • SheetUpdater: This add-on provides a simple way to update your Google Sheets with new data.
  • Data Refresh: This add-on allows you to refresh your Google Sheets with new data from an external source.

To install an add-on, follow these steps:

  1. Open your Google Sheet and click on the “Add-ons” menu.
  2. Click on “Get add-ons” to open the Google Workspace Marketplace.
  3. Search for the add-on you want to install and click on the “Install” button.
  4. Follow the installation instructions to complete the installation.

Best Practices for Automating Google Sheets Updates

When automating Google Sheets updates, there are several best practices to keep in mind:

Use a Reliable Data Source

Make sure that your data source is reliable and trustworthy. If your data source is unreliable, your automated updates may be inaccurate or incomplete.

Test Your Script or Add-on

Before automating your Google Sheets updates, make sure to test your script or add-on to ensure that it works correctly. This will help you identify any errors or issues before they become a problem. (See Also: How to Add a Percentage Formula in Google Sheets? Effortlessly Calculate)

Monitor Your Updates

Monitor your automated updates to ensure that they are working correctly and to identify any issues that may arise. This can help you troubleshoot any problems and ensure that your data is accurate and up-to-date.

Conclusion

Automating Google Sheets updates can save you time and reduce the risk of human error. By using Google Apps Script or Google Sheets add-ons, you can create custom scripts that update your spreadsheets automatically. Remember to use a reliable data source, test your script or add-on, and monitor your updates to ensure that they are working correctly. With these tips and best practices, you can keep your Google Sheets up-to-date and accurate, without having to spend hours updating each sheet individually.

FAQs

Q: What is the best way to automate Google Sheets updates?

A: The best way to automate Google Sheets updates depends on your specific needs and requirements. You can use Google Apps Script or Google Sheets add-ons to create custom scripts that update your spreadsheets automatically.

Q: How do I use Google Apps Script to automate Google Sheets updates?

A: To use Google Apps Script to automate Google Sheets updates, you’ll need to create a new script by clicking on the “Create” button in the Google Apps Script editor. Write your script using the Apps Script language, and then save and run it to execute it.

Q: What are some common issues that can occur when automating Google Sheets updates?

A: Some common issues that can occur when automating Google Sheets updates include errors, data inconsistencies, and formatting issues. To troubleshoot these issues, make sure to test your script or add-on thoroughly and monitor your updates to identify any problems that may arise.

Q: Can I use Google Sheets add-ons to automate Google Sheets updates?

A: Yes, you can use Google Sheets add-ons to automate Google Sheets updates. There are many add-ons available that can help you automate updates, such as AutoUpdate, SheetUpdater, and Data Refresh.

Q: How do I troubleshoot issues with automated Google Sheets updates?

A: To troubleshoot issues with automated Google Sheets updates, make sure to test your script or add-on thoroughly and monitor your updates to identify any problems that may arise. You can also use the Google Apps Script debugger to identify and fix errors in your script.

Leave a Comment